In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
eventfs: Fix use-after-free in eventfs_remove_rec()
eventfs_remove_rec() recursively removes the child at the current loop
position. After the recursive call returns, list_for_each_entry() advances
by reading list.next from the removed child.
If free_ei() drops the final reference, release_ei() reuses the list/rcu
union to queue an SRCU callback. The child may be freed before that read.
The eventfs_mutex serializes list updates, but it does not keep the removed
child alive or prevent the SRCU callback from running.
Use list_for_each_entry_safe() to save the next sibling before recursively
removing the current child.
